Location: Farnborough, Hampshire, United Kingdom
This is a site-based role supporting data centre logistics operations across EMEA. The Logistics Engineer is responsible for the safe receipt, storage, tracking and movement of technology equipment, ensuring accurate inventory records, compliance with client and internal processes, and excellent service delivery to internal teams and customers.
What you'll be doing as our Logistics Engineer - Data Centre Services:
- Managing the receipt, storage, movement and secure disposal of data centre equipment, while keeping inventory, purchase order and asset records accurate and up to date.
- Following client and ONNEC processes, health and safety requirements, quality standards and escalation procedures to maintain service levels and audit readiness.
- Working closely with internal teams, customers, couriers and vendors to support projects, site transfers, reporting and continuous service improvement.
What we're looking for in our Logistics Engineer - Data Centre Services:
- Experience working in a data centre and/or banking IT environment, with knowledge of asset management, ticketing systems and service delivery processes.
- Strong organisational skills, attention to detail and the ability to prioritise, multitask and work accurately under pressure.
- Good communication skills, confidence using MS Office, and a professional, flexible approach to working independently and as part of a team.
